The
Boston Globe had yet another story today about Romney's largess
with conservative groups. A former IRS commissioner questions
whether the Romney foundation "charitable" giving was in fact
merely a disguised effort to boost his candidacy, a charge the
Romney camp denies. This is not the first look at this issue. There
was this
report and more recently this
report about Romney's PAC(since disbanded) which spread money
around to South Carolina conservative groups. Romney has not yet
released financial documents which would spell out the full extent
of his foundation's charitable giving but has maintained through
his spokesman that he simply is supporting conservative causes in
which he believes. Perhaps. It is hard for Romney's opponents to
get to the right of him on issues since he has aligned himself with
very few exceptions( No Child Left Behind being one) with the GOP
base on a wide range of issues so some of his opponents
--especially Thompson(who has raised the "buying" the election
theme) and Huckabee -- may make more of an issue of his spending
patterns.
